一、破解技术入门:环境准备与工具选择
对于新手玩家,破解果盘游戏的第一步是搭建逆向工程环境。根据吾爱破解论坛的逆向工程教程,推荐使用Windows系统配合OllyDbg(OD)、IDA Pro等工具,这类工具能解析程序汇编代码并定位关键跳转点。以果盘游戏《球球英雄》果盘版为例,其2025年4月版本(v5.3.0.2)采用Unity引擎开发,需额外配备dnSpy进行C反编译。
硬件方面,建议配置至少8GB内存和SSD硬盘,以应对动态调试时的高负载。数据统计显示,使用虚拟机环境(如VMware)可降低系统崩溃风险,但需注意部分反调试机制可能检测虚拟机运行。
二、基础破解:静态分析与字符串定位
针对无壳或简单加密的果盘游戏,静态分析是入门核心。以《果盘游戏乐园》为例,通过OD加载程序后,使用“搜索字符串”功能查找如“充值失败”“VIP等级不足”等关键词,可快速定位验证逻辑。据测试,2025年3月版本中,约65%的本地验证逻辑通过此类方式暴露。
若字符串被加密(如异或运算),需结合代码层逆向。例如《球球英雄》果盘版的VIP标识符采用与0x2异或加密,通过编写Python脚本可还原明文:
python
encrypted_str = "D2 F0 C3 D2 B8 C7 D7
decrypted = [chr(int(b, 16) ^ 0x2) for b in encrypted_str.split]
print(''.join(decrypted)) 输出“序列号正确”
此方法在吾爱破解论坛的C++示例中已验证有效。
三、进阶技巧:动态调试与代码注入
对于采用动态加载或网络验证的果盘游戏(如《果盘游戏至尊版》),需使用OD的断点功能。在充值回调函数(如libil2cpp.so中的IAPManager_OnPurchaseComplete)设置断点,可拦截支付状态码。数据显示,2025年版本中约80%的支付漏洞存在于本地回调校验环节。
硬核玩家可尝试HOOK技术,以Frida框架为例,注入以下脚本可绕过VIP等级检测:
javascript
Interceptor.attach(Module.findExportByName("libgame.so", "CheckVipStatus"), {
onLeave: function(retval) {
retval.replace(0x1); // 强制返回VIP激活状态
});
该技术在《绿色征途果盘版》中实测成功率达92%。
四、硬核对抗:内核级破解与版本更新应对
针对果盘游戏2025年4月更新的反调试机制(如Ptrace检测),需采用内核级工具如WinDbg或定制化Xposed模块。以《战双帕弥什果盘版》为例,其反破解系统采用双重校验:
1. 签名校验:修改APK签名后,需修补libsigncheck.so中的VerifySignature函数。
2. 环境检测:通过Hook系统API(如getprop)伪造设备指纹。
版本更新方面,开发者每季度平均发布1-2次安全补丁。破解社区统计显示,约70%的旧漏洞在新版本中仍可复用,建议优先分析更新日志中的“安全优化”条目。
五、数据验证:成功率与风险量化
根据果盘游戏破解社区2025年抽样数据:
以《海岛奇兵果盘版》为例,其资源修改漏洞在v52.1.1版本修复后,仍有15%的玩家通过内存偏移修正法实现延续利用。
六、边界:合法学习与风险规避
需明确技术研究的边界:
1. 合法范围:仅限单机模式或自有账号测试,避免修改他人数据。
2. 风险案例:2024年某破解小组因篡改《果盘游戏》充值协议被判赔偿120万元,凸显法律后果。
3. 替代方案:推荐使用官方折扣渠道,如果盘游戏的“1折充值”活动,可实现低成本正版体验。
破解技术是一把双刃剑,本文旨在解析技术原理而非鼓励非法行为。建议玩家结合自身需求,在合法框架内探索游戏机制,并关注果盘游戏官方动态以获取最佳体验。